  • Project description
    The project will mobilize resource-poor farmers to raise tree plantations on farmlands. It proposes to link resource poor farmers and end users of wood products in order to optimize the land use and to facilitate the co-ordination of wood producers, agronomists, financial institutions and non governmental organizations to improve the livelihood opportunities of rural households. The project activity is implemented on the degraded farmlands or lands used for rainfed subsistence agriculture. The project objectives are: - Generating high-quality greenhouse gas removals by sinks. - Developing plantation and agro forestry models, which can provide multiple benefits to farmers in terms of timber, firewood and non-wood forest products. - Providing additional income and to promote livelihoods of resource poor farmers through carbon revenues. - Reforesting degraded lands to control soil and water erosion and reclaim lands. - Reducing the dependence of industry on natural forests thereby conserving biodiversity. - Building capacity of various stakeholders to benefit from global mechanisms.
